This is how I landed upon the Chilipad Sleep System. What is the Chilipad Sleep System? The Chilipad Sleep System is a mattress pad that connects, through a long, flat tube, to a temperature-regulating cube. To use it, you pour water into the cube (more information on that in a minute) and set a temperature from a dial on the cube or a remote control that comes with it.
The cube is where the magic takes place, heating and cooling water (depending upon what the user wants when they sleep), prior to pumping the temperature-controlled water through television into the pad, which is filled with smaller sized silicone tubes. On its site, the Chilipad's makers declare sleeping on it increases sleep quality, makes users revitalized throughout the day, eliminates night sweats, and restores "natural rhythms" (this one is from a video review from man who wrote a book called "Paleo Manifesto").
